this was actually so much more enjoyable than expected, a different genre compared to twilight and didn’t read as if it were by the same author at all. a really great dystopian novel with some amazing character building and plot lines. one thing i didn’t enjoy was the romantic side, it felt like it was missing something and honestly i found the love interest uncomfortable, though i can’t quite put my finger on that. was also missing the climax that i was looking forward to, which did make the story overall read whistle flat, as there seemed to be no real risk past a certain point. extremely easy to read and i felt myself get lost in it - i do love me some dystopia/ end of the world fiction.
